Output ddfb8950a13069be16504d206090671d358e263298618f1164b380249f4472d7:0

value
43223
script pubkey
OP_0 OP_PUSHBYTES_20 6a70b799831089e871b6892b189a079f72ac7118
address
bc1qdfct0xvrzzy7sudk3y433xs8nae2cugcsehjpc
transaction
ddfb8950a13069be16504d206090671d358e263298618f1164b380249f4472d7
spent
true